Transaction 99c64122c710e8ec4a0c32e82b107cf803047fe3b83d5557454e801cd1e62146
1 Input
1 Output
-
99c64122c710e8ec4a0c32e82b107cf803047fe3b83d5557454e801cd1e62146:0
- value
- 29909
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2e1f6378e6c6d1799c837d1baa10bb3d3f412026 OP_EQUAL
- address
- 35ttcHQEAC9Yobm4vYL68YqxCpCAJK8P84